How Much Do Florida Wedding Venues Cost?

Your wedding budget in Florida typically scales with guest count:

  • 50 guests: $19,395
  • 100 guests: $32,141
  • 150 guests: $44,126
  • 200 guests: $54,841
  • 250 guests: $65,555
  • 300 guests: $76,270

You'll find the average venue costs around $7,110 which represents 16% of your total wedding budget. This typically ranges from $6,400 to $7,800 - actually coming in below the national benchmark of $6,500-$12,000 where venues usually eat up 25% of total costs.

How Should You Plan Around Florida's Weather?

Florida's climate means you need to consider hurricane season running from June through November. Look for venues with covered outdoor areas that maintain aesthetic appeal during sudden rain showers. Properties with climate-controlled indoor spaces offer seamless transitions when weather changes unexpectedly so your celebration continues without interruption.
